Lisa Buziewicz and Mike Kottmann had the smallest of weddings with the biggest of hearts. How many folks watched them exchange vows July 20, 2012 at the lovely Holy Rosary church in Washington, D.C.? 100? 50? Try 12, including the bride and groom.
And that's all they needed.
Their families came down from Pennsylvania, cupcakes featuring the Starbucks logo, a place special to Lisa and Mike, were made by hand, and the entire wedding party sat around one table on the roof of the Hay Adams hotel.
Simple.
But with the light behind them fading and the White House looming large, their nieces and nephews all clanking glasses waiting for a kiss and their parents laughing hysterically, all I could do is think of that Visa commercial, the one that ends with:
Priceless.
